I am considering moving some of mine to go under my star magnolia, as that area under it is tough to weed etc. so they would being dense not let any growth under them happen. it would be an experiment to see just how much shade they can handle. anyway, last year on a whim I planted some in the hallow center areas of two stumps, and they are blooming nicely. tough plants.
